Skip to main content

A command to watch for new hex files from upyed and flash the micro:bit immediately

Project description

A command to watch for new hex files from https://github.com/ntoll/upyed and flash the micro:bit immediately

upyflashed will poll your browser download directory for new hex files. If one is found it will copy it to the micro:bit storage location.

Note: The approach attempts to be cross platform but bug reports / fixes gratefully accepted. Currently only tested on Linux and Windows.

Installation

pip install upyflashed

Usage

$ upyflashed --help
usage: upyflashed [-h] [--download_path DOWNLOAD_PATH]
                  [--microbit_path MICROBIT_PATH] [-v]

A command to watch for new hex files from https://github.com/ntoll/upyed and
flash the micro:bit immediately

optional arguments:
  -h, --help            show this help message and exit
  --download_path DOWNLOAD_PATH
                        Filepath your browser stores downloads
  --microbit_path MICROBIT_PATH
                        Filepath your computer mounts the micro:bit at
  -v, --verbose

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

upyflashed-0.1.0.tar.gz (2.5 kB view details)

Uploaded Source

Built Distribution

upyflashed-0.1.0-py2.py3-none-any.whl (4.6 kB view details)

Uploaded Python 2 Python 3

File details

Details for the file upyflashed-0.1.0.tar.gz.

File metadata

  • Download URL: upyflashed-0.1.0.tar.gz
  • Upload date:
  • Size: 2.5 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No

File hashes

Hashes for upyflashed-0.1.0.tar.gz
Algorithm Hash digest
SHA256 d1be7d2ca37915aa8f8b47fbe4e819fd097a65347a1703bfadd6790f64ce95b4
MD5 90b0a46dda5bd5236d207a894aa9336b
BLAKE2b-256 8f7ecc15091feeaf5c3b119a7fc55ee31414ed54f856aea0b44f21caf4bcf8ac

See more details on using hashes here.

File details

Details for the file upyflashed-0.1.0-py2.py3-none-any.whl.

File metadata

File hashes

Hashes for upyflashed-0.1.0-py2.py3-none-any.whl
Algorithm Hash digest
SHA256 e9e4014fcd34a37dafa9ccc3083bb2151462167e2739e36fd44d2cd85c6ce723
MD5 9c6a7a8dcb1fbb1ba9a6f06cfb66ed0a
BLAKE2b-256 8db9efe71efc89a0d26d5277578a7414180c08caf921605ba293e772674cf1f2

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page